  3. 14 hours ago, DonnaML said:

    Wow. Fantastic! Did you find it yourself?

    Hi Donna, I found that brick at the very edge of the field..Farmers are bothered by these large bricks and stones when cultivating the field, so they throw them at the end of the fields, outside the arable land..The farmer told me, that many years ago, all the farmers who have land in that area, gathered those bricks and marble slabs into one pile and took it to local landfill..To my horror, he added, that some marble slabs had inscriptions, but they could not read it!
